微软近日宣布,将MS-DOS V4.0的源代码开源。这一操作系统版本最初于1988年发布,是微软与IBM合作的成果。现在,这一历史性的代码已在MIT许可下发布,供公众查阅和研究。十年前,微软曾向计算机历史博物馆发布了MS-DOS 1.25和2.0的源代码。今天,微软继续这一传统,不仅发布了MS-DOS V4.0的源代码,还包括了一些未公布...
MS-DOS 系统汇编环境之DOSBOX+vim 经过虚拟机的体验,我发现还是dosbox里汇编比较方便。。。 一、下载安装 dosbox DOSBOX 准备好masm.exe、link.exe、debug.exe,放在~/dos下(文件夹名字随便取)。 打开dosbox,输入mount c ~/dos,把名为dos的文件夹挂载到dos系统 二、VIM安装 在dosbox 中 C:cdvim73 install 三...
网上的这个直接用还不行,DOS在7.0以前的版本文件名最多8个字节,因此需要修改一些文件名,vimrc_example.vim会变成vimrc~1.vim,用move命令改回来就好了,然后c:\dos\vim.bat中的一些路径的引号也要去掉,才能正常使用。 _vimrc在C:\根目录下。 安装masm 从网上下载好 masm后,不能直接放到虚拟机里的 DOS 系统...
MS-DOS 系统汇编环境之DOSBOX+vim 经过虚拟机的体验,我发现还是dosbox里汇编比较方便。。。 一、下载安装 dosbox DOSBOX 准备好 masm.exe、link.exe、debug.exe,放在~/dos下(文件夹名字随便取)。 打开dosbox,输入mount c ~/dos,把名为dos的文件夹挂载到dos系统 二、VIM安装 在dosbox 中 C: cd vim73 install...
MS-DOS 7.0(1995年):随Windows 95一同发布,不单独发行。 MS-DOS 7.1(1997年):支持FAT32文件系统。 MS-DOS 8.0(2000年):随Windows ME发布,主要用于启动和安装系统。 早在2018年,微软已经开源了v1.25、v2.0两个版本,本次新增了v4.0版本: MS-DOS操作系统主要是由汇编语言编写的,虽然是16位实模式时代的汇编,...
MS-DOS,全称Microsoft Disk Operating System,是由微软打造的操作系统,主要服务于个人计算机。在1981年至1990年代初期,它曾是市场上最受欢迎的操作系统之一,与早期个人计算机的发展紧密相连,承载着深厚的历史意义。由于MS-DOS系统主要采用汇编语言编写,尽管是16位实模式时代的产物,但对于程序员们,尤其是大学生们...
将一个应用程序从 CP/M 移植到这个新操作系统的过程,只需将 8080 或 Z80 汇编程序转换为 8086(使用 Tim Paterson 编写的另一个工具)并进行手工优化即可。 后来,这款系统更改为 86-DOS,微软收购了该操作系统,Tim Paterson 随之加入微软,全职开发该操作系统。显然,没过多久,他立即被告知是在为 IBM 工作。随后...
十年前,微软将 MS-DOS 1.25 和 2.0的源代码发布到计算机历史博物馆,而后在 2018 年于 GitHub 上重新开源了 MS-DOS(https://github.com/microsoft/MS-DOS)。这段代码在历史上占有重要地位,对于仅 45 年前完全用 8086 汇编代码编写的操作系统而言,具有非常好的研究意义。
这是为新生产线汇编的代码,代码的灵感来自于写字机。我们的教授给我们讲了这个故事,但是我的英语不好...
微软透露,MS-DOS 1.25/2.0的所有源代码都是用8086汇编码写的,其中86-DOS的代码最初完成于1980年12月29日,MS-DOS 1.25的代码来自于1983年5月9日(并不是最早的版本),只有7个文件,包括最初的MS-DOS命令行外壳。 微软重新开源MS-DOS 1.25/2.0(图片源自网络) ...